Heat sign Michael Beasley for balance of season

The Miami Heat announced today that they have signed forward Michael Beasley for the remainder of the season. Per club policy, terms of the deal were not disclosed.

Beasley has appeared in 10 games with the Heat this season averaging 9.5 points, 3.9 rebounds and 22.9 minutes while shooting 42.4 percent from the field. He has scored in double-figures five times, including a season-high 18 points vs. Sacramento on March 7, and grabbed a season-high nine rebounds at Toronto on March 13.

Beasley, who was signed to a 10-day contract by the Heat on February 26 and then re-signed to a second 10-day contract on March 8, was originally drafted by Miami in the first round (second overall) in the 2008 NBA Draft.

The six-year NBA veteran has appeared in 419 career NBA games (199 starts) averaging 13.2 points, 4.9 rebounds, 1.3 assists and 24.8 minutes while shooting 45 percent from the field.
